Delight your taste buds with Cocomacadana Bread, a tropical-inspired quick bread that combines the creamy richness of coconut milk, the nutty crunch of macadamia nuts, and the subtle sweetness of shredded coconut. This easy-to-make loaf is perfectly soft and moist, thanks to the flavorful blend of melted butter and coconut milk, while a touch of vanilla adds warmth to every bite. With just 15 minutes of prep time and a single bowl for wet and dry ingredients, this recipe is perfect for both seasoned bakers and beginners looking for a simple yet indulgent treat. Serve it as a satisfying breakfast, a midday snack, or a decadent dessert paired with a dollop of whipped cream or a drizzle of honey. Whether you’re celebrating the flavors of the tropics or simply craving a unique twist on classic quick bread, Cocomacadana Bread promises to become a favorite in your recipe rotation.

π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

11 items
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 0.75 cups granulated sugar
  • 1 cup shredded unsweetened coconut
  • 0.75 cups chopped macadamia nuts
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oons baking soda
  • 0.25 teaspoons salt
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 cups coconut milk
  • 2 whole large eggs
  • 1 teaspoons vanilla extract

πŸ“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C) and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, shredded coconut, chopped macadamia nuts,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Set aside.

3

In a separate bowl, combine the melted unsalted butter, coconut milk, eggs, and vanilla extract. Whisk until well blended.

4

Gradually p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ients, stirring gently with a spatula just until combined. Do not overmix; the batter should be slightly lumpy.

5

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, spreading it evenly with the spatula.

6

Bake in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

7

Remove the loaf pan from the oven and let the bread cool in the pan for about 10 minutes. Then, trans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ing and serving.

8

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days or in the refrigerator for up to 1 week. For longer storage, freeze individual slices and reheat as needed.
